|
|||||||
|
|
|
![]() |
|
|
Strumenti |
|
|
#1 |
|
Member
Iscritto dal: May 2003
Messaggi: 56
|
oracle+jsp:gestione apici e doppi apici
Come risolvere il problema?
se in un form html inserisco la stringa: L'aquila e la passo tramite jsp ad un db di oracle, ci sono problemi di riconoscimento degli apici, lo stesso vale per i doppi!! chi mi aiuta? |
|
|
|
|
|
#2 |
|
Senior Member
Iscritto dal: Jun 2002
Città: Firenze
Messaggi: 630
|
Prova ad usare la sequenza di "escape" corrispondente agli apici, cioè al posto di ' metti \' .
__________________
---> Lombardp CSS Certified Expert (Master Level) at Experts-Exchange Proud user of LITHIUM forum : CPU technology Webmaster of SEVEN-SEGMENTS : Elettronica per modellismo |
|
|
|
|
|
#3 |
|
Bannato
Iscritto dal: Jan 2001
Messaggi: 1976
|
hai provato col carattere ascii ?
una cosa tipo char(39) o chr(39): 'L' & chr(39) & 'aquila' |
|
|
|
|
|
#4 | |
|
Bannato
Iscritto dal: Jan 2001
Messaggi: 1976
|
Quote:
mhhhh ... che bravo e anche in oracle hai realizzato un ... totogol ? o piuttosto la costante invariante è il p.d.f ? [/siz] </OT> |
|
|
|
|
|
|
#5 |
|
Senior Member
Iscritto dal: Mar 2002
Città: Roma - Milano - Lagos
Messaggi: 8579
|
Ad Oracle per inserire nel db il carattere apice ', lo devi passare doppio, ovvero 2 volte '' (sono 2 apici singoli)... quindi devi parsare la stringa e rimpiazzare gli ' con 2 apici
Pero' questo non dovrebbe accadere se per inviare la query a Oracle usi un PreparedStatement al quale setti i parametri, piuttosto che la query inviata con Connection.executeQuery(String query)
__________________
--- --- VENDO AppleCare per Macbook Pro 15"/17" a 200E --- --- Ho trattato con mezzo forum, per l'altra meta' mi sto attrezzando... Perditempo di professione: signirr |
|
|
|
|
| Strumenti | |
|
|
Tutti gli orari sono GMT +1. Ora sono le: 08:10.



















